  • BP platform in the North Sea forced to shut after oil spill

    October 3, 2016

    BP closed an oil platform in the North Sea after an oil spill was reported over the weekend. The oil major’s Clair platform, which is about 46 miles west of Scotland’s Shetland Islands in the North Sea, has been shut while an investigation is conducted into the leak which occurred yesterday.   • BAE Systems gets £1.3bn to start building new nuclear submarines

    October 2, 2016

    BAE Systems has been given a further £1.3bn by the Ministry of Defence (MoD) to start building Britain’s next generation of nuclear submarines. The funding will cover initial manufacturing work that is due to commence next week. It will also be used to develop the design of the submarines, purchase materials and invest in BAE’s yard [...]

  • Ovo Energy makes first profit as smart meter push pays off

    September 30, 2016

    Independent energy supplier Ovo made a pre-tax profit for the first time in its seven-year history, helped by improved customer tenure and as "being a first mover with smart meters paid off". The company said today that its pre-tax profit hit £30.4m in the six months to 30 June, up from a loss of £3.6m a year earlier. [...]
